A general concept: if f(x,y,z(x,y))=0 then differentiating with respect to x and y gets:
fx+fzzx=0
fy+fzzy=0
when zx=zy=0 , you'll get fx=fy=0.
So solve for the partials of f with respect to x and y are 0.
fx=4x−12y+4z=0
fy=6y−12x=0
solving for x,y as functions of z:
x=z/5,y=2z/5
Plug those into the original:
2z2/25+12z2/25+z2−24z2/25+8z2/25=35
23z2=875
z=±6.17
